2000 Rupee Note from Black Paper! A Fraud Caught by Police!

A guy named Nallamalai from Usilampatti was arrested who indulged in a fraudulent act of changing black papers to Rs. 2000 currency notes. 

He was caught by Sheikh Abdullah, a Sub-Inspector of Police from Vathalakundu who was involved in a vehicle test. When he checked the car coming from Usilampatti towards Vathalakundu, it had black sheets and a plastic barrel. When he questioned the driver, he answered uncertainty. When the suspect opened the plastic barrel in the car, some 2000 rupee notes were found in it.

Further investigation by the police on suspicion found that Nallamalai has cheating people by soaking the black paper into the chemical liquid he owns, then it will turn into a two thousand rupee note. But he lets the black paper inside liquid instead he gives the original 2000 rupee note that he has already kept aside him.

Police confiscated black paper notes and his used car. The investigation revealed that there were various fraud cases against Nallamalai in the Theni and Tirunelveli districts, including possession of a counterfeit firearm. 

Police arrested Nallamalai and produced him in Nilakkottai court. Later they remanded him in custody.
